What You Need for Measurement

Before we dive into the procedure, gather a few essential items:

  1. Formaldehyde testing kit
  2. Protective gloves
  3. Disposable containers or bags
  4. A notebook for recording your findings

Steps to Measure Formaldehyde Concentration in Plants

Let’s get started with the measurement. Follow these simple steps to ensure accurate results:

1. Prepare Your Space

Choose a well-ventilated area to conduct your testing. Natural light is beneficial, and it helps in observing any samples clearly.

2. Collect Samples

Using the gloves, carefully collect a few leaves or stems from the plant. Place them in a disposable container to avoid contamination.

3. Use the Testing Kit

Open your formaldehyde testing kit. Different kits may vary slightly, so be sure to follow the specific instructions provided. Generally, you will:

  1. Add the plant samples to the provided solution or testing materials.
  2. Let the samples sit for the recommended time, often around 20-30 minutes.

4. Analyze the Results

Check the color change or any indicators provided in the kit. This will show you the formaldehyde concentration in your plant samples. If the color is more intense, it indicates higher levels of formaldehyde.

5. Record Your Findings

Jot down your observations in your notebook. Note the date, time, plant type, and the formaldehyde level. This data can help in monitoring changes over time.
